Advanced Technologies in Water Extraction and Drying



While managing water damage can be overwhelming, sophisticated innovations in extraction and drying make the procedure a lot a lot more effective. You'll find that specialized equipment like high-powered pumps and commercial vacuums can rapidly eliminate standing water, decreasing the danger of further damage. These equipments not only remove water but also enhance the drying procedure.


Following, you'll observe the use of dehumidifiers and air moving companies. These gadgets interact to reduced humidity degrees and circulate air, speeding up dissipation. water mitigation company. By purposefully positioning them, you can ensure that every affected location dries out extensively


Thermal imaging electronic cameras likewise play an essential duty, as they assist you determine covert wetness pockets that typical techniques might miss out on. This way, you can attend to all damp areas, preventing future problems. With these advanced devices, your water repair initiatives end up being a lot more effective, permitting you to return to typical life quicker.


Avoiding Mold Growth After Water Damages



To properly avoid mold development after water damages, it's important to act swiftly and decisively. Begin by getting rid of any standing water instantly, as mold thrives in moist environments. Use pumps or wet vacuum cleaners to remove as much wetness as feasible. After that, dry the impacted areas thoroughly; open windows, utilize fans, or utilize dehumidifiers to reduce humidity i was reading this degrees.


Following, tidy and disinfect surfaces with a mix of water and detergent, and think about making use of a mold-inhibiting solution for added security. Pay unique attention to hidden areas like behind walls and below floor covering, where wetness can linger unnoticed.


Lastly, monitor the location closely for any type of indications of mold and mildew. If you detect any kind of, address it quickly to stop more spread. By taking these proactive steps, you can considerably reduce the risk of mold growth, guaranteeing a healthier environment in the aftermath of water damages.

DIY vs. Expert Water Reconstruction Services





When it concerns water restoration, just how do you decide in between taking on the work yourself and working with specialists? Assess the level of the damages. If it's small-- like a small leakage or a soaked rug-- you might handle it with some do it yourself approaches. You can rent out a wet/dry vacuum cleaner, use followers, and use mold preventions to dry points out.


However, if the damages is comprehensive or involves contaminated water, it's best to contact the professionals. Professionals have specialized devices, training, and experience, guaranteeing safe and extensive restoration. They can identify surprise wetness and stop future issues, like mold and mildew development.


Inevitably, consider your time, skills, and the prospective risks. While do it yourself can conserve Visit This Link money, hiring experts can give satisfaction, specifically for significant damage. Making the best selection will certainly safeguard your home and your wellness.

How Can I Recognize Hidden Water Damage in My Home?



To identify surprise water damage, look for water discolorations, mold and mildew development, or warped walls. Use a moisture meter in suspicious locations, and evaluate your pipes for leaks. Count on your impulses-- if something appears off, explore better.


What Are the Indicators of a Mold Trouble After Water Damage?



After water damage, you'll notice moldy smells, visible mold development, and enhanced moisture. Try to find dark places on wall surfaces or ceilings, and watch out for peeling paint or distorted surface areas. Do not disregard these indications!


How much time Does the Water Repair Process Typically Take?



The water restoration procedure generally takes anywhere from a couple of days to a number of weeks. It depends upon the degree of the damages, the products involved, and exactly how promptly you deal with the issue.


Exist Any Health And Wellness Dangers Associated With Water Damages?



Yes, there are health and wellness threats connected with water damage. Mold development, bacteria, and structural problems can bring about respiratory problems, allergies, and various other diseases. It's vital to deal with water damages without delay to lessen these risks.


What Should I Do Before Professionals Get Here for Reconstruction?





Before experts get here, you must turn off the electrical energy, remove prized possessions from the location, and start drying surfaces with towels. If secure, open windows for air flow to assist avoid further damages and mold growth.
